Job Description

Business Operations Coordinator

Location: Oxnard CA

Classification: – Non-exempt Employment

Type: Full-time, at will

Department: Operations

Reports To: Chief Operating Officer (COO)

Job Summary

We are seeking a proactive, detail-oriented, and highly organized individual to join the team. The Business Operations Coordinator plays a key role in ensuring the smooth execution of administrative and operational activities in our North American, Oxnard office. This position combines hands-on administrative execution with cross-departmental coordination, providing to the leadership team in managing processes, reports. We are looking for a trustworthy and motivated individual, who in total compliance helping to streamline business processes and improve overall efficiency.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Financial Record-Keeping
  • Provide and maintain accurate and up-to-date financial records, including accounts payable, general ledger entries, and bank reconciliations.
  • Enter data into the accounting system and ensure the integrity of financial information.

Transaction Processing

  • Process and review financial transactions, such as invoices, bills, payments, expense reports, and purchase orders.
  • Verify the accuracy and completeness of supporting documentation.
  • Ensure timely and accurate recording of transactions in compliance with established policies and procedures.
  • Cooperate with the Leone headquarter financial dept. to ensure smooth intercompany operations

Accounts Payable

  • Manage the accounts payable function, including vendor invoice processing, payment preparation, and vendor communication.
  • Reconcile vendor statements, resolve discrepancies, and follow up on outstanding issues.
  • Maintain vendor records and update payment terms as necessary.
  • Issue proforma invoices and bill credit to vendors for defective products.

Taxes

  • Work closely with the COO, CPA and the external consultants to fulfil the fiscal obligations
  • Sales Tax filing
